About this item

  • 8x4 bonded downstream/upstream channel for superior throughput
  • Built in MoCA® immunity filter
  • Two independent 96MHz wide RF tuners to receive downstream channels up to 1GHz
  • Meet or exceed industry radiated immunity and surge requirements
  • Please check with your Internet Service Provider for compatibility in your home or office
  • Flexible NxM downstream/upstream channel bonding for superior throughput


The Touchstone DOCSIS 3.0 8x4 Cable Modem CM820A delivers ultra-high speed data access to cable service subscribers homes and businesses. Designed to support the services desired most by advanced users, the CM820A enables the home or small business user to address productivity needs with the speed and performance found only in the 8x4 bonded channel cable environment along with industry-leading ARRIS reliability. With the CM820A, cable operators can offer data services at speeds greater than 300Mbps to their subscribers to compete against VDSL and fiber to the home threats, as well as provide a platform to deliver competitive high capacity commercial services to businesses.

It's not beautiful by any means but the performance more than makes up for it. Using it with Comcast Cable in March of 2016.The 802A is actually the retail model of this device and is on Comcast's approved equipment list while this 802 was meant to be distributed by cable providers and is not on the list. However, it will work and was easy to set up.When you call Comcast to activate the equipment just tell them it is the 802A and give them the seriel number on the device and Comcast will be none the wiser (it shouldn't matter anyway, but better to play it safe).Took about 10 minutes on the phone to get it activated.Provides stable performance and is better than the equipment Comcast provides these days.Buying your own modem will save you $10 a month on the equipment rental, paying for itself in just a few months.I have Blast speed from Comcast and actually get better than advertised speeds with this device (90 Mbps down and 15 Mbps up).Make sure you have your own wireless router if you want to set up a wireless home network, as this device is just a simple cable modem and not a cable modem/wireless gateway like the equipment you likely have from Comcast right now.

Bought the Modem to replace the fees and upgrade from an old Thompson Modem. I did the self install: Connected the modem and the router all at once with a wired connection to the laptop as well. After it booted up, then said it need some activation, so i logged (open the browser and the page got redirected by itself to comcast self installation page) in to comcast and put in my information (e.g. account number and phone number). It then showed the changes that were going to happen switching: from an older modem to a new one. It cycled (e.g. rebooted) and then it asked to leave it alone for 5 minutes while it downloaded updates. I did that and then gave both modem and router a reboot. It connected perfectly and didn't have to call comcast. :)
